Transit & Commuting to Boston

One of the top draws to Quincy, Braintree, and parts of Weymouth is the **MBTA Red Line**. Stations at **Quincy Center**, **Quincy Adams**, and **Braintree** connect directly into Boston without needing to park. The **Braintree branch** is especially convenient for South Shore residents.

Complementing the Red Line, the **Commuter Rail’s Greenbush**, **Middleborough**, and **Kingston** lines serve regional routes. Local buses (e.g. 230, 238, 240, 241) shuttle residents from neighborhoods to Red Line hubs and throughout Weymouth into Quincy.

Highway access via **Route 3**, **Route 93**, and **I-93** gives more commuting flexibility. Many luxury buildings offer reserved parking, EV charging, and shuttle options to transit centers.

Beaches, Parks & Local Highlights

  • Wollaston Beach — Boston’s closest beach; sandy stretch, walking paths, kiosks and summer vibes.
  • Broad Cove & Quincy Shoreline — great for tidal walks, sunrises, and water access.
  • Blue Hills Reservation — hiking, lookouts, trails just minutes away.
  • Webb Memorial & Great Esker Park (Weymouth) — accessible waterfront trails, biking, nature escapes.
  • Quincy Quarries Reservation — former blast quarry now walking paths, rock climbing, hidden urban wilds.
  • South Shore Plaza (Braintree) — regional retail and dining hub.
  • Historic Quincy sites — Adams National Historical Park, the USS Salem, and local museums.

Weekends: drive down to the South Shore’s lesser-known beaches (Squantum, Wollaston) or take a quick Red Line ride into Boston for major cultural spots.
